#5496eb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5496eb is composed of 32.9% red, 58.8%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.3% cyan, 36.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 213.8 degrees, a saturation of 79.1% and a lightness of 62.5%. #5496eb color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#002dd7.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#5496eb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5496eb has RGB values of R:84, G:150, B:235 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.36,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 5543659.

Shades and Tints of #5496eb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010205 is the darkest color, while #f2f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5496eb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9fa2 is the less saturated color, while #4594fa is the most saturated one.
